
Kathmandu, 18 June: The International Relations Committee of the House of Representatives has summoned Prime Minister Sher Bahadur Deuba for a discussion. Prime Minister Deuba has been summoned to the committee meeting to be held tomorrow at 10 am.The parliamentary panel will grill Prime Minister about the controversial State Partnership Program (SPP).
There will also be discussions on Prime Minister Deuba's upcoming visit to the United States. Earlier on Friday, the Foreign Minister and the Chief of Army Staff were summoned by a parliamentary committee for a discussion on the SPP.
